golang更新太慢

admin 2024-10-12 11:10:13 编程 来源:ZONE.CI 全球网 0 阅读模式

为什么Golang更新太慢?

作为一个专业的Golang开发者,我常常关注Golang的版本更新。然而,相对于其他编程语言而言,Golang的更新速度确实相对较慢。那么,为什么Golang更新如此之慢呢?下面我将从几个方面进行分析。

Golang更新周期较长

在Golang的更新过程中,不同版本的发布速度存在着明显的差异。这一差异主要源于Golang开发团队制定的更新周期。相比于其他编程语言,Golang的更新周期较长。这一点可以从Golang 1.0版本发布至今已经超过10年的时间来得到体现。

在一定程度上,这种较长的更新周期确保了Golang的稳定性和兼容性。每个版本的发布都经历了较长时间的测试和验证,以确保Golang的运行环境更加健壮和可靠。这也是Golang备受开发者喜爱的原因之一。

重点关注向后兼容性

相比于频繁地发布新版本,Golang的更新更多地关注向后兼容性。在Golang的更新过程中,开发团队更注重于为旧版Golang提供长期支持,并通过小版本的更新来修复漏洞和改进性能。这种方案的确保了用户的项目能够平稳过渡并受益于新版本的优化。

同时,Golang还注重保证代码的稳定性和可维护性。在引入新特性或改变语言行为时,开发团队通常会更谨慎地将其引入到新版本中。这种保守的态度使得Golang的更新速度相对较慢,但也确保了代码的一致性和可靠性。

开发团队规模和目标

与其他编程语言相比,Golang的开发团队规模相对较小。虽然Go语言有一批非常优秀的开发者和贡献者,但相对于一些大型编程语言社区而言,规模还是稍显不足。

这一方面影响了Golang的更新速度,因为开发团队所能投入的时间和精力有限。另一方面,这样的小团队也意味着Golang的开发目标相对集中。Golang更注重于提供高效、简洁和易用的编程环境,而不是追求功能的华丽和全面。这也是Golang长期以来保持稳定性和一致性的体现。

综上所述,Golang更新较慢的原因主要包括更新周期较长、重点关注向后兼容性以及开发团队规模和目标等。虽然这可能影响到某些开发者对于新功能的期待,但同时也为Golang提供了更加稳定和可靠的编程环境。作为Golang开发者,我们应当理解并尊重这种更新策略,并通过参与开源社区和贡献自己的力量来推动Golang的进一步发展。

weinxin
版权声明
本站原创文章转载请注明文章出处及链接,谢谢合作!
golang更新太慢 编程

golang更新太慢

为什么Golang更新太慢? 作为一个专业的Golang开发者,我常常关注Golang的版本更新。然而,相对于其他编程语言而言,Golang的更新速度确实相对较
golang函数式 库 编程

golang函数式 库

使用Golang函数式库进行高级编程什么是Golang函数式库? Golang函数式库是一组用来增强Golang编程体验的开发工具和函数。这些函数式库提供了各种
golang error和panic 编程

golang error和panic

Golang中的错误处理和异常处理错误处理是每个编程语言中都必不可少的一部分,Golang提供了一套简单而强大的机制来处理异常情况和错误。在本文中,我们将讨论G
golang bi数据分析 编程

golang bi数据分析

近年来,随着大数据和人工智能的蓬勃发展,数据分析在各行业中扮演着至关重要的角色。特别是在互联网行业中,数据分析更是成为了企业决策和产品优化的核心驱动力。而作为一
评论:0   参与:  0